Molecular Formula C61H98O24
Molecular Weight 1215.40 g/mol
Exact Mass 1214.64480399 g/mol
Topological Polar Surface Area (TPSA) 284.00 Ų
XlogP 2.20
Atomic LogP (AlogP) 3.22
H-Bond Acceptor 24
H-Bond Donor 5
Rotatable Bonds 17
